UN reform needed according to president of General Assembly 66th elected president of the UN General Assembly, Nassir Abdulaziz al-Nasser urges UN reform in a recent interview saying that the attitude of Russia and China towards Syria proves how the given rules are unsuitable for solving crises like this. “The world has changed; the UN should also reform itself to deal with the issues of today. Sixty years ago who could imagine we’ll be discussing climate change, food security, or the world would reach seven billion people, so we need to see a more active and effective UN.
